Relocating as a single retiree requires balancing affordability, healthcare access, and opportunities for social connection without the built-in support of a spouse. Navigating this transition means prioritizing states that stretch a single income further through favorable tax policies while offering robust communities where you can easily build a new network. Finding the right destination involves looking beyond postcard scenery to evaluate housing costs, access to top-tier medical facilities, and vibrant local cultures tailored to active older adults. This guide highlights the ten best states that offer single retirees the ideal mix of financial stability, physical well-being, and lifestyle enrichment, giving you the practical criteria needed to confidently choose your next hometown.
